The size of Longreach is approximately 23494.5 square kilometres. It has 18 parks covering nearly 1.1% of total area. The population of Longreach in 2016 was 2970 people. By 2021 the population was 3124 showing a population growth of 5.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Longreach is 50-59 years. Households in Longreach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Longreach work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 53.10% of the homes in Longreach were owner-occupied compared with 52.60% in 2016.
